|   |   | Heribert C. Ottersbach: Formation Towards AbstractionEdited by Carola Kemme. Text by Ralf Beil.
Beginning with archival materials and his own photographs and drawings, German artist Heribert C. Ottersbach paints subjects--often architectural--that allow him to reevaluate Modernism. He calls his paintings "abstract, geometric figurations of a society disciplined by 'education.'"
